What is the department for headaches in children

Depending on the severity of the headache and the accompanying symptoms, the department in which the headache occurs in a child should be chosen. The main departments that are often consulted are pediatric internal medicine, pediatric neurology, otorhinolaryngology or ophthalmology. 1. Pediatric internal medicine: If a child has an acute headache accompanied by symptoms such as coughing, nasal congestion and runny nose, it is often considered that the headache may be caused by an upper respiratory tract infection, and it is recommended to consult pediatric internal medicine in this case. 2. Pediatric Neurology: If children have headaches for a long time, and the headache symptoms are severe and intolerable, and often nausea, vomiting symptoms, this case, it is considered that it may be due to brain tumors, encephalitis, meningitis and other diseases, it is recommended to consult the Pediatric Neurology Department. 3. Otorhinolaryngology or ophthalmology: If the headache is caused by glaucoma or sinusitis, it is recommended to consult ophthalmology or otorhinolaryngology. When children have headache symptoms, especially frequent recurrence of headache, should be timely to the regular hospital, diagnose the cause, give targeted treatment and conditioning.
